You can call it nepotism, partiality or what you will but I would like to present my husband Dwight McFee with the Actor of the Year Award.
Having a trained voice, benefit of 4 years of the Honours Acting Program at University of Alberta and nearly a hundred plays and a hundred film and TV shows to his credit, my darling husband gave a smashing performance at Chapters for the Brian Mulroney book signing. He told me he was going to heckle the Brian and I was a little trepidatious, as befits the wife of an actor activist with ‘balls’ – I could only imagine, and so I insisted on being there, since with the loss of his best friend Keith Knight to the hateful big C, he is now working alone.
We assembled with the crowd and I asked Dwight why he chose to stand upstairs and not where the interview would take place..he pointed to the door behind us..point taken and then pointed out the CSIS suits and the Undercover Security which is why we needed the door. We were there to make the point but not disrupt the meeting otherwise we’d be in jail.
The moment came, the former PM walked into the crowd like Great Caesar at the Forum, arms raised triumphantly, and in his best actor voice Dwight’s “BOOO!” rang out and filled the entire Chapters in the Manu Life Center. Sorry Heather, it may not have been the way you envisioned it, but if the polite Canadian citizens still insist on embracing insipid politesse instead of healthy dissent, so be it.
A fellow next to us, quietly remarked, “shame”, perhaps he was originally from South Africa, where I noticed people have the habit of responding to things with either a “shame” or “pleasure”. Dwight replied “shame on you for supporting this man” and continued his “booing” as opposed to ‘boohoohooing’ until three little fellows made it up the stairway to us, and insisted that we leave immediately. Very nicely Dwight asked if dissent was not allowed in our country…”this is private property” they replied..ah yes, of course..but hey we’re not Americans who have the right to property in their Constitution, we’re Canucks and we believe in airing our concerns to the powers that be or not.
We left quietly, Dwight to an audition and I do my Monday night acting group.
I was VERY PROUD of my husband. He delivered a magnificent performance!
Here he speaks for himself to CTV Talkback which posed the question: Do you hate or love Mulroney.
Dwight McFee to Talkback: It's not a matter of 'hating' Mr. Mulroney, but holding His Hubris accountable for his policies, actions and what some Canadians would consider betrayal; as Mr. Mulroney and a large sector of the financial, political and media elite continue the revisionist rehabilitation of the former Prime Minister of the United States of North America.
What should the Presidential Prime Minister be held accountable for? A few examples:
- The recent canard that Pierre Trudeau left the biggest deficit in the history of the nation. The media, if they were at all interested, with a simple investigation, would find that accounting for inflation, proportionally a much larger debt was incurred at the end of the Second World War, and after the depression. Mr. Trudeau faced two oil shocks, a recession and the end of the Vietnam War. If that's too onerous for the news reader, a simple statement that Mr. Mulroney and Mr. Mazinkowski increased the debt to the nation by at least five times in the Golden Eighties, which was followed, after his cowardly exit, by threats from the IMF, the World Bank and 'Wall Street' of adjustment programs unless we shaped up.
- The day Mr. Mulroney exited the sinking ship, The Benevolent One ordered that SEVENTY BILLION Canadian dollars of inherited wealth could move offshore without being taxed for the next twenty years. I noticed at the Reisman Regalia event last night, many grateful old family scions in the audience.
-In 1987 Flora MacDonald, Minister of Culture at the time, was to introduce legislation making fifteen percent of the cinema screens available to Canadian product, similar to the CanCon regulations for radio. Mr. Jack Valente the powerful President of the AMPPA came screaming into Ms. MacDonald’s office and then to the Prime Minister's, telling the PM that if he wanted a free trade deal forgetaboutit! Next day that was dead.
-The American negotiator for the Free Trade agreement has stated that the American's couldn't understand why Canada kept offering so much they didn't ask for but of course would accept. It would still have to be American 'law' though, but we'll take it. Big Shot Brian immediately went into pre-emptive surrender.
- Where's the $300,000. Schreiber dollars? As well, the air bus scandal has not been completely resolved, only that the RCMP screwed up, but the money trail goes somewhere?
- These are only a few events that need to be remembered, but the last and best from Mr. Democracy is the lying in the elections. More than sixty percent of Canadians voted against the Free Trade agreement. But the Bully from Bay Comeau barged on with what really was a financial services agreement, in the face of world opposition to bi-lateral trade agreements (an international round was underway), to please his latest Colonel McCormick, Ronny 'the ripper' Regan.
